If your Motorola Moto G Power 5G screen is broken, has cracks, black spots, or lines across it or if parts of the screen don’t respond to touch, that’s a sign your screen is not working. Flickering or has a blank display also means the screen is likely damaged. These instructions show you how to replace your screen.

Slide an iFixit opening pick along the edge of the phone to loosen the back. Work slowly around the phone until the back cover begins to lift.

Use the iFixit opening pick to gently remove the back camera cover.
-
Remove the three 2.2 mm screws that were underneath the back camera cover using a Torx T5 screwdriver.

Insert SD Card remover into the hole next to the SD Card holder and remove the whole SD Card and its holder.

Remove the outer casing from the phone by sliding along the edges. Start from underneath the section of where the SD card was removed.

Warm up an iFixit iOpener for 30 secs.
-
Place the iFixit iOpener on the battery to loosen the screen's adhesive.
-
To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order.
